Abstract
Named data networking (NDN) is an emerging network architecture for serving content-centric applications, which are intended to support diverse services that require various quality of service (QoS) levels. In this paper, an algorithm based on ant colony optimisation—the so-called service-differentiated QoS routing algorithm (SDQR)—is proposed for service-differentiated routing of different types of services in NDN. SDQR adds a control layer on top of NDN to manipulate the underlying forwarding information base (FIB). The FIB defines an evaluation matrix to achieve differentiated updates on pheromone concentrations for different types of services. Simulation results showed that SDQR achieves service-differentiated routing for different types of services with less delay and higher throughput than several conventional approaches.
Similar content being viewed by others
References
Xylomenos G, Ververidis CN, Siris VA et al (2014) A survey of information-centric networking research. IEEE Commun Surv Tut 16:1024–1049
Ahlgren B, Dannewitz C, Imbrenda C et al (2012) A survey of information-centric networking. IEEE Commun Mag 50:26–36
Ioannou A, Weber S (2016) A survey of caching policies and forwarding mechanisms in information-centric networking. IEEE Commun. Surv. Tut. 18:2847–2886
Hou R, Fang L, Chang Y, Yang L, Wang F (2017) Named data networking over WDM-based optical networks. IEEE Netw 31:70–79
Ota K, Dong M, Gui J et al (2018) QUOIN: incentive mechanisms for crowd sensing networks. IEEE Netw 32:114–119
Jia Q, Xie R, Huang T et al (2017) The collaboration for content delivery and network infrastructures: a Survey. IEEE Access, pp, 1–1
Li B, Ma M, Jin Z, Zhao D (2012) Investigation of large-scale P2P VoD overlay network by measurement. Peer Peer Netw Appl 5:398–411
Xie G, Ota K, Dong M et al (2017) Energy-efficient routing for mobile data collectors in wireless sensor networks with obstacles. Peer Peer Netw Appl 10:472–483
Zhang L, Afanasyev A, Burke J et al (2014) Named data networking. ACM SIGCOMM Comp Com 3:66–73
Fang C, Yu FR, Huang T et al (2015) A survey of green information-centric networking: research issues and challenges. IEEE Commun Surv Tut 3:1455–1472
Akinniranye AA, Oyetunji SA (2013) Resource optimisation for 3rd generation partnership project (3GPP) long term evolution OFDMA downlink interface air. Wirel Eng Technol 4:188–197
Ding G, Shi L, Wu X et al (2012) Improved ant colony algorithm with multi-strategies for QoS routing problems. Proc. 2012 8th Int. Conf. Natural Comput. (ICNC), 2012, pp. 767–771
Sugathapala I, Glisic S, Juntti M, et al Joint optimization of power consumption and load balancing in wireless dynamic network architecture. IEEE Int. Conf. on Commun. (ICC), 2017, pp. 121–125
Deng X, He L, Zhu C et al (2016) QoS-aware and load-balance routing for IEEE 802.11s based neighborhood area network in smart grid. Wirel Pers Commun 89:1065–1088
Dong M, Ota K, Liu A et al (2016) Joint optimization of lifetime and transport delay under reliability constraint wireless sensor networks. IEEE Trans Parall Distr 27:225–236
Bari MF, Chowdhury SR, Ahmed R et al (2012) A survey of naming and routing in information-centric networks. IEEE Commun Mag 50:44–53
Wu Q, Li Z, Zhou J et al (2014) SOFIA: toward service-oriented information centric networking. IEEE Netw 28:12–18
Khan AZ, Baqai S, Dogar FR (2012) QoS aware path selection in content centric networks. Proc. 2012 IEEE Int. Conf. on Commun. (ICC), 2012, pp. 2645–2649
Li C, Okamura K, Liu W (2013) Ant colony based forwarding method for content-centric networking. Proc. 27th Int. Conf. Adv. Inform. Networking Applic. Workshops (WAINA), 2013, pp. 306–311
Chengming LI, Wenjing LIU, Okamura K (2012) A greedy ant colony forwarding algorithm for named data networking. Proc Asia-Pacific Advanced Network (APAN), pp 17–26
Shanbhag S, Schwan N, Rimac I et al (2011) SoCCeR: services over content-centric routing. ACM SIGCOMM Workshop on Information-centric Networking, pp 62–67
Huang Q, Luo F (2016) Ant-colony optimization based QoS routing in named data networking. J Comput Methods Sci Eng 16:671–682
Eymann J, Giel AT (2013) Multipath transmission in content centric networking using a probabilistic ant-routing mechanism. 5th International Conference on Mobile Networks and Management (MONAMI), 2013, pp.45–50
Kerrouche A, Senoucl MR Mellouk A, Abreu T (2017) Ant colony based QoS-aware forwarding strategy for routing in named data networking. IEEE International Conference on Communications (ICC), 2017, pp.1–6
Huang P, Chen J (2013) Improved CCN routing based on the combination of genetic algorithm and ant colony optimization. 3rd International Conference on Computer Science and Network Technology (ICCSNT), 2013, pp. 846–849
Afanasyev A, Moiseenko I, Zhang L (2012) ndnSIM: NDN simulator for NS-3. Technical Report NDN-0005, University of California, Los Angeles
Salama HF, Reeves DS, Viniotis Y (1997) Evaluation of multicast routing algorithms for real-time communication on high-speed networks. IEEE J Sel Area Comm 15:332–345
Acknowledgements
This work was supported by the National Natural Science Foundation of China under Grant 60841001 and the Special Fund for Basic Scientific Research of Central Colleges, South-Central University for Nationalities, under Grant No. CZD18003. The authors thank all the reviewers for their useful comments.
Author information
Authors and Affiliations
Corresponding author
Additional information
Publisher’s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
About this article
Cite this article
Hou, R., Zhang, L., Zheng, Y. et al. Service-differentiated QoS routing based on ant colony optimisation for named data networking. Peer-to-Peer Netw. Appl. 12, 740–750 (2019). https://doi.org/10.1007/s12083-018-0669-6
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s12083-018-0669-6